Walkway Sealing in Kitsap County, WA
Walkway sealing services involve applying protective coatings to concrete, stone, or paver pathways to enhance durability and appearance. This process helps guard against damage from moisture, stains, and wear caused by foot traffic and weather conditions. Projects typically include sealing front walkways, side paths, or patios to maintain their condition and extend their lifespan. Property owners often want to understand the types of sealants used, the benefits of sealing, and how it can improve the look and longevity of their walkways before requesting service.
Homeowners should consider the current condition of their walkways, including cracks, stains, or surface wear, to determine if sealing is appropriate. It’s also helpful to inquire about the drying and curing times, as well as any necessary preparations or ongoing maintenance. Proper sealing can help preserve the integrity of the surface and improve curb appeal, making it a valuable step in maintaining the property’s exterior.

Walkway Sealing Questions
What types of walkways benefit from sealing? Concrete, asphalt, and stone walkways can all benefit from sealing to protect against weathering and stains.
How does sealing extend a walkway’s lifespan? Sealing helps prevent cracks, surface damage, and erosion caused by moisture and UV exposure.
Is walkway sealing suitable for new surfaces? Yes, sealing can be applied to new walkways to provide long-term protection from the start.
What maintenance is needed after sealing? Regular cleaning is recommended to keep the sealed surface in good condition and maintain its appearance.
